#68e956 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68e956 is composed of 40.8% red, 91.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 112.7 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 62.5%. #68e956 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ffac with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#68e956 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68e956 has RGB values of R:104, G:233,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6875478.

Shades and Tints of #68e956
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68e956
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a09f is the less saturated color, while #5df847 is the most saturated one.
